Tourists stranded at Sonmarg following snowfall on Wednesday were evacuated by police and shifted to safer places.

Over 50 tourists at Sonmarg were evacuated by Ganderbal Police after they received information about their presence.

The operation was launched on the direction of SSP Ganderbal Nikhal Borkar and was supervised by SDPO Yasir Qadri.

A police official said that police drove a number of vehicles from Gagangeer to Sonmarg and brought them back to Ganderbal wherefrom they left for Srinagar.

Many tourists had headed to the higher reaches of Sonmarg to enjoy snowfall despite the police advisory.

As the snow continued, over 50 tourists got stranded in Sonmarg.

SHOs from Gund and Sonmarg police stations were also part of the operation. (KNT)
